The Pocono region is enjoying a renaissance with an influx of investment in new resorts, luxurious spas and attractions. In an era when time has become one of the most precious commodities, the Pocono Mountains region has become an invaluable resource for world-weary vacationers who find comfort in knowing that there is a place that's both nearby and near-perfect for any kind of escape experience. 

Famous for its breathtaking views and rushing waterfalls, the Pocono Mountains are a year-round vacation spot. For a fun-filled Poconos experience in the winter, ski the slopes, ride a snowmobile or mush your own dogsled team. Enjoy the laurel blossoms that bloom in the spring or shop at the outlets or specialty stores. Orienteer your way through the mountains on horseback or by bike in the Pocono Mountains this summer. Tee off at a golf course or sample a micro-brew this fall. Choose any, or all, of these activities for your perfect Poconos escape.

Great Brews of America Beerfest

The two-day indoor festival at Split Rock Resort and Golf Club will feature close to 30 of America's finest classic and micro-breweries offering tastes of their latest brews. Musical entertainment will be performed on two different stages, while crafts and artwork will be on exhibition and for sale.  Each attendee will receive a commemorative beer tasting glass to take home and be at least 21 years of age to enter.  Seminars on various beer related topics will be featured throughout the festival.
